// Context for support: the settlement tests intermittently fail when the
// mock ledger responds slower than 2s, which the retry wrapper misreads
// as a declined charge. This fixture pins the mock latency to 500ms and
// seeds three deterministic transactions so reruns are stable.
// If a customer escalation references failing settlements, check whether
// the same timeout pattern appears in their logs before filing a bug.
// The fixture authenticates against the sandbox gateway using the token below.

session JWT of tadup-kaguf = eyJhbGciOiJIUzI1NiIsInR5cCI6IkpXVCJ9.eyJzdWIiOiItNz4V3In0.KrZCeqpk

Subject: Quickstore 4.2 — bloom filter now fronts the KV layer

Plugin authors: starting with this release, Quickstore places a bloom filter ahead of the key-value store. Negative lookups return faster; false positives fall through safely. No API changes are required on your side. Verify your plugin against the staging build referenced below.

session token of fahif-tadup = htk3_9c7

Ticket: Staging env misconfigured for Siftgate bloom filter

The bloom layer in front of the Pellet KV store is rejecting all lookups in staging because the env file was copied from the dev template without credentials. False-positive tuning values are fine; only the auth line is missing. To unblock the weekly demo, the Pellet admission secret must be set on the following line.

env line for yaguf-fajop: LEDGER_TOKEN13=fb08984397349

Subject: Scheduled key rotation for PickPath Optimizer

Team,

As part of our quarterly review, we rotated the credential used by the PickPath Optimizer to call the Slotting Service. Please confirm the diff in config/pickpath.yaml matches this change before approving. Old keys remain valid until Friday noon. The new key for the Slotting Service is below.

gateway credential: kto23_LX9A4ys6i4nzHtpOLNLodKK